Hamilton – ‘I owe nothing to this sport'

Lewis Hamilton has revealed that he has given too much to Formula 1, with a career spanning almost 10 years, to owe anything to it. Hamilton argued that he has spent of his career promoting the sport than any other driver in its history, bringing fame and popularity on a global scale. Already winning three World Championships, the Brit explained that he has given everything to F1 and added that he feels he has no more to give. 'I've been here for 10 years, given my blood, sweat and tears for the sport. So, I don't feel like I owe it anything,' Hamilton told CNN.
